Meaning of full-blood |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B2

Definitions

  1. A pure-bred animal.
  2. An Aboriginal person of unmixed ancestry.
    Australia, offensive

Examples

“There are only 800 full-bloods now in New South Wales due to the maladministration of previous governments.”
“Dorahy has his mouth ready to smile […] but it is a young woman who appears, a full-blood with crisp hair and a deeply pigmented skin.”
